The General Affidavit Form with Signature in Virginia is a critical legal document used to affirm the truthfulness of statements made by an individual, known as the affiant. This form requires the affiant to provide personal details, including their name, residency, and the county and state of their affirmation. It is designed to be filled out and signed before a notary public, who validates the authenticity of the signature and the oath taken by the affiant. Key features of the form include a dedicated space for the affiant's statement and the date of signing. For attorneys, paralegals, and legal assistants, this form serves various purposes, including supporting court cases, verifying facts in legal documents, and authenticating testimony when necessary. Partners and owners may utilize this affidavit to assert ownership claims or validate transactions. Overall, the General Affidavit Form is an essential tool for individuals engaged in legal matters, ensuring that sworn statements are documented and recognized under Virginia law.
